The Opportunity
As our Procurement Sourcing Specialist, you’ll be at the heart of our sourcing activities across direct and indirect categories, working alongside experienced procurement category managers to execute sourcing strategies across Australia and New Zealand. This role can either be based in Sydney - Australia, Swanbank – Australia or Auckland – New Zealand. You’ll be responsible for:
- End-to-End Sourcing: Managing RFPs, negotiating with suppliers, and designing sourcing strategies aligned with business objectives.
- Digital Transformation: Supporting our digital procurement journey by efficiently using Coupa and other tools to drive sourcing and supplier collaboration.
- Stakeholder Engagement: Collaborating with internal teams and business requestors, fostering relationships that align sourcing initiatives with business goals.
- Data-Driven Insights: Providing essential data and analytics to support the development of key sourcing strategies.
What’s in your toolkit?
To enable you to hit the ground running, we’re looking for:
- Essential Experience: A minimum of 3 years of experience in procurement, sourcing, or supply chain management.
- Technical Skills: Proficiency in Excel to manage and analyse data effectively. Familiarity with Coupa, SAP, or Ariba is a bonus!
- Education Background: A business degree, computer science, engineering, or food science will set you up for success in this role.
- Stakeholder Management: Excellent relationship-building abilities, with a knack for influencing and collaborating across multiple functions.
- Adaptability: A flexible, agile approach as you contribute to Suntory Oceania’s ongoing transformation.
- Analytical Skills: Strong analytical abilities to interpret complex data, identify trends, and drive informed decisions.
- Communication Skills: Strong verbal and written communication skills to effectively articulate ideas to both internal teams and external suppliers.
- Presentation Skills: Exceptional presentation skills, with the ability to convey key insights and strategies clearly and compellingly to diverse audiences.
